
Steve (Steven) Brock lives in Adelaide with his wife and eight-year-old daughter. He has lived and travelled widely in South America, and has published his poetry and translations from the Spanish in a range of journals. In 2003 Steve completed a PhD in Australian literature at Flinders University, and he currently works as a speech writer and policy officer. He recently translated an anthology of Mapuche poets from Chile with Juan Garrido Salgado.

'Live at Mr Jake's is immediately engaging and unpretentiously breezy. But don't let that fool you. What seems simple never is. Steve Brock shows us that the everyday is where the important things happen, at home, in the office, on the street. His poems are shifty in the very best sense, they wander all round the world and into places where irony meets sincerity, upheaval meets grace, reading jostles against misreading. And it's there that the magic happens.' - Jill Jones

'Sparse, elegant, moving, funny, Brock's poetry demonstrates how much can be achieved when poetry is clear, direct and looks out at the world with empathy and sincerity. Live at Mr Jake's is a superb gathering of observations and encounters, an engaging collection of finely-crafted snapshots.' - Peter Boyle
